Within the broader LGBTQ+ spectrum, the transgender community represents a diverse group of individuals whose gender identity—their internal sense of being male, female, or another gender—differs from the sex they were assigned at birth. Transgender culture is a vibrant intersection of historical traditions, modern social movements, and shared experiences of identity and resilience. The Flashpoints of Controversy
- Healthcare Bans: Laws preventing transgender minors from accessing puberty blockers or hormone replacement therapy (HRT), despite every major medical association (AMA, APA, AAP) endorsing such care as life-saving.
- Sports Bans: Legislation excluding trans girls and women from school sports, often based on unscientific claims about biological advantage.
- Drag Bans: Laws criminalizing "public drag performance," which implicitly target trans identity and gender-nonconforming expression.
The "Trans" Umbrella: This term includes various identities, such as non-binary, genderqueer, and genderfluid, for those whose gender does not fit strictly into the male/female binary.
